Iranian Strikes on US Bases Cause $800 Million Damage, New Analysis Shows
Iranian strikes on US bases have caused an estimated $800 million in damages, according to a newly released independent analysis that challenges earlier official assessments. The report reveals that the scale of destruction to military infrastructure was significantly higher than initially acknowledged, raising concerns over regional security and escalating geopolitical tensions.
The analysis provides a detailed breakdown of the targeted facilities, financial costs, and operational disruptions, offering a clearer picture of the aftermath of the strikes.
Extent of Damage from Iranian Strikes on US Bases
The Iranian strikes on US bases reportedly targeted multiple high-value military installations, including airbases and logistical hubs. According to defense analysts, the damage included:
Severe structural damage to aircraft hangars
Destruction of surveillance and radar systems
Damage to ammunition storage facilities
Runway impacts that temporarily halted flight operations
Experts estimate that rebuilding and repair costs alone could exceed $800 million, not including indirect operational losses.
